Palantir’s AI Boom: A Stock to Watch

This year, Palantir has emerged as a major topic of conversation, particularly in the context of artificial intelligence (AI). The company’s AI tools have gained significant traction, driving its stock price up significantly, with a remarkable 143% increase in value year to date as of August 14.

If someone had invested $100 in Palantir three years ago, that investment would now be worth over $1,850. That’s quite an impressive return, to say the least.

While Palantir’s primary business model has stayed consistent, perceptions about the company have shifted. It was once primarily viewed as a niche government contractor, but now there’s a growing recognition of its potential in commercial sectors as well.

In the second quarter, Palantir reported its first billion-dollar revenue—up 48% from last year—with significant contributions from both government and commercial sectors, which increased by 53% and 93% respectively.

However, following such substantial gains, there’s a cautionary note for potential investors. Currently, Palantir’s stock trades at nearly 135 times its sales, which raises questions about sustainability. This valuation seems high, even by more tolerant standards.

Though Palantir has established itself as a leader in its industry, expecting similar returns in the next three years might be overly optimistic. If you’re considering investing, it might be wise to adopt a long-term perspective and brace yourself for some market fluctuations along the way.
